Further raids on Pattaya Constructors Campsites in Pattaya

camp-21.jpg

PATTAYA: -- On Friday further raids took place at constructor’s campsites which were suspected of housing illegal foreign workers.

The raids took place around the District and were led by Banglamung District Officials who were assisted by officers from the Royal Thai Air Force and Ministry of Defense.
